Source: Lek Lim Nonya Cake Confectionery
Description
Also known as Red Turtle Cake, these traditional snacks consist of a soft, sticky glutinous rice flour skin wrapped around sweet fillings like peanut or bean paste, molded into a turtle shell shape symbolizing longevity.
